Full-Scale Tests on Single-Tapered Glulam Members

Publication: Journal of the Structural Division
Volume 108, Issue 10

Abstract

Analytical and experimental studies were conducted on Glulam members with tapered configuration. Full-scale flexural tests were conducted under working loads. Three different geometries were investigated; namely a beam, an arch leg and an arch rafter. Each geometry was replicated in Douglas-fir and Southern pine species. Strain and deflection were measured and compared with theoretical predictions obtained by a finite element modeling. Load tests were also performed to failure. Stress results indicate that current design computations yield highly conservative stress levels. A commonly used interaction equation is evaluated in light of the ultimate strength results observed in the tests to destruction.
